The Siena Art Institute is a non-profit organization, and it is central to our mission to provide assistance and opportunities to those in need.  We believe that everyone should be given the chance to study abroad.  For this reason, we  are proud to offer generous merit- and need- based scholarships to assist our applicants in covering the cost of tuition for our programs.  We also encourage students to seek additional sources of funding.

The Siena Art Institute is keenly aware that it can be quite difficult for students and their families to amass the necessary funding for their college tuition costs, and study abroad programs can be notoriously expensive.  We diligently work to maintain a low overhead without compromising the quality of our instruction and facilities.  Our scholarship program and financial aid services allow us to make our programs accessible to as many students as possible.   It is important to understand that The Siena Art Institute’s scholarships can not cover course fees, art materials, travel expenses, or food and lodging.  Even those students who receive full scholarships must be prepared to budget for these expenses.  However, the expense of a study-abroad experience should be thought of as an investment whose invaluable benefits will last a lifetime, as it will forever change your perspective on the world and the place of your artwork within it.
